The Computerized National Identity Card (CNIC) is a crucial document in Pakistan, issued by the National Database and Registration Authority (NADRA). It serves as an official identification card for Pakistani citizens, verifying identity and citizenship. What is a CNIC?
The CNIC is a unique identity card issued to Pakistani citizens aged 18 and above. It contains vital personal information, including:
- Full Name
- Father’s/Husband’s Name
- Date of Birth
- CNIC Number (13-digit unique identifier)
- Photograph
- Permanent Address
- Fingerprint
Importance of CNIC in Pakistan
The CNIC is a mandatory document for Pakistani citizens, essential for various official processes such as:
- Voter Registration: Required for voting in national, provincial, and local elections.
- Banking and Financial Services: Necessary to open bank accounts and perform financial transactions.
- Employment and Government Benefits: Employers and government programs require a valid CNIC for registration.
- Travel and Passport Services: A valid CNIC is required to apply for a passport and travel within the country.
How to Apply for a CNIC
Applying for a CNIC in Pakistan is a simple process. Here’s how you can do it:
- Step 1: Visit NADRA Center: You need to visit your nearest NADRA registration center with the required documents.
- Step 2: Submit Documents: Submit your birth certificate, B-form, or any other required documentation to verify your identity and citizenship.
- Step 3: Biometric Data: Your photograph, fingerprints, and signature will be captured electronically at the center.
- Step 4: CNIC Processing: After submitting your application, your CNIC will be processed and delivered within a few weeks.
Renewing or Replacing a CNIC
If your CNIC is lost, expired, or needs to be updated, you can apply for a renewal or replacement. The renewal process is similar to the original application, but you must provide your previous CNIC or a copy of it. Replacement applications may also require a police report if the CNIC is lost or stolen.
Online CNIC Verification and Tracking
NADRA offers online services for verifying and tracking CNICs. Using the CNIC Verification System, citizens can verify the validity of their CNIC or check the status of their CNIC application. This service ensures transparency and helps prevent identity fraud.
